Our Statement of Belief

2nd May 2022

Our latest ‘Statement of Belief’ is “I recognise comfortable and uncomfortable feelings.”

- - - - - - -

Time to talk: At St John Fisher we know that we all have the right to feel happy, safe and loved, in and out of school, every single day.

We know the things in our lives that make us feel safe and comfortable and we also know when something (or someone) makes us feel less safe and uncomfortable. If anything (or anyone) ever makes us feel like this then we know that we can find any grown-up in school and tell, tell, tell!

If you share a worry, then you will always be listened to and your worry will always be taken seriously. We will then make sure that you receive the love, care, encouragement, help and support that you need, so that you can let go of your worry ball.
